The other day, Huawei introduced the Pura 70 series, which includes the manufacturer’s brand new flagship smartphones. TechInsights analyst Sui Qian believes the manufacturer could sell more than 10 million units of these devices this year if it doesn’t face production issues and keeps pricing reasonable.

The prediction published by the analyst applies primarily to the Pro, Pro+ and Ultra models. He also claimed that the product line will increase Huawei’s sales revenue and contribute to the manufacturer’s growth in general.

Huawei Pura 70 Ultra

The new series consists of the Huawei Pura 70, Pura 70 Pro, Pura 70 Pro+ and Pura 70 Ultra models. Each novelty is powered by the Kirin 9010 chipset. Of course, the coolest and most interesting device of all is the Pura 70 Ultra, which has a 50-megapixel, 1-inch sensor, moving lens camera.
